What is a 4 inch SS304 cabinet and interior door hinge?
A 4 inch SS304 cabinet and interior door hinge is a stainless steel flush or butt‑style hinge used mainly on wooden cabinets, cupboards, and light interior doors. SS304 steel provides strong corrosion resistance, making the hinge suitable for long‑term use in homes, hotels, hospitals, and commercial interiors.

Where are 4 inch flush hinges commonly used?
Flush hinges in this size are widely used on kitchen cabinets, wardrobes, cupboards, and light interior doors where a neat, low‑profile look is required. Because they do not require deep mortising, carpenters can install them quickly on furniture and interior joinery.
Are SS304 flush hinges suitable for heavy or main entrance doors?
Flush hinges are ideal for light to medium‑weight doors and furniture but are not recommended for very heavy or main entrance doors. For heavy doors, most experts suggest stronger butt or continuous hinges with higher load capacity.
What should bulk buyers check before placing a large order?
Bulk buyers should confirm material grade (SS304), hinge size and thickness, hole pattern, finish, and load recommendations for their target doors. It is also wise to review packing style, HS code documentation, and quality tests (salt‑spray, cycle tests) to avoid claims after import.
Which HS codes are commonly used for exporting stainless steel door hinges?
Stainless steel door hinges typically fall under HS code group 8302, often reported as codes such as 830210 or 830241 depending on country classification. Buyers should verify the exact code with their customs broker to match local import regulations and duty structures.
